Battle of Aqaba facts for kids

Kids Encyclopedia Facts

The Battle of Aqaba was an important battle during World War I. It happened on July 6, 1917. The battle was fought between the Ottoman Empire and the Arab Revolt. The Ottomans were part of the Central Powers and the Arab Revolt was part of the Allied Powers.

The city of Aqaba, located in modern-day Jordan, was a very important coastal city and port. The Ottomans controlled Aqaba. They had strong defenses along the coast. However, they did not expect an attack from inland. This was because they thought the Arabian Desert behind the city was too difficult to cross.

The Arab Revolt, led by the Arab chief Auda Abu Tayi and British officer T. E. Lawrence, decided to try the impossible. They marched across the Arabian Desert towards Aqaba. This surprise attack caught the Ottomans off guard. The Arab Revolt successfully captured the city.
